This is the problem that you have at the moment. You aren't singing in the same key as the music that you are singing to.
This is what you need to be able to do to be a professional singer.
1 Sing in tune. Autotune is for slight variations in tuning it isn't going to help someone who basically can't sing in the same key as the background music, that problem needs specialist help.
2 You need to even up the sound of your voice so that all the words are on the same kind of tone. This takes years of practice and lessons with a qualified voice coach.
3 There are natural singers, but even natural singers need lessons on diction and breath control. You aren't a natural singer (because of the tuning issues) so how do you expect to get any better without lessons?
4 Professional singers can sing in tune without any background music to help them pitch.
5 Professional singers are professional because people pay to listen to them sing. This means that people like to listen to them. What I would suggest is that instead of dreaming about one day waking up and finding that you can sing, that you take some direct action to make sure that one day you actually are able to sing well.
Your first step is to go for some singing lessons, with a qualified singing teacher, to learn to sing in tune, correct breath control, voice production, posture, how to look after your voice, etc. The voice is like any other musical instrument you have to learn how to make it sound its best, so that people really want to listen to you sing. When you get to this stage, people will ask you to sing for them. You won't need to post recordings on Y! A or youtube because you will be being asked to sing in performances. This is another benefit that a teacher gives you. They create opportunities for you to sing. The lessons have to be with a teacher who is in the same room as the one you are singing in.
